MEMO — Sales Leads

Requesting approval for an additional 40k to the Q3 field budget for the Vantorel launch. Travel caps stay in place; the increase covers demo kits and the Halden trade fair only. Submit regional needs to Priya Okker by Friday. No exceptions after that. Approval expected Monday. The rationale ties directly to what follows below.

management briefing: Jorixax Holdings is in early talks to buy Casixax Holdings for about $420.3 million. The Fenmir launch date is October 27, and nothing goes to the press before then. Legal wants the Keloxek Foods term sheet redrafted before April 16.

### Step 4: Swap in the new reset flow

Alright, this is the fun part. The revamped password reset in Keyloft replaces the old emailed-token dance with short-lived, single-use reset grants. Before you flip the switch, make sure the legacy reset endpoint is in read-only mode — otherwise users mid-flow get stranded. Rollback is just reverting the config, so don't sweat it too much. Once the old endpoint is drained, apply the settings below to enable the new flow.

deployment values, taweg-bajop:
[fenvan]
port = 5672
team = holmir
host = fenvan.orvexio.example
region = lower-1
access_code = ac_b98bc6
timeout_ms = 1500

Hey plugin folks —

Heads up: we're moving the Corvid build over to Hermetica, our new hermetic build system. That means no more network fetches at build time, so vendor your plugin deps or declare them in the lockfile. Deadline is end of next quarter. If anything breaks or the docs confuse you, drop a note here.

escalation mailbox, bafog-fafog: ulador@paliqlabs.internal